WebMar 25, 2024 · The bur oak is a vast native Florida oak tree with light brown to gray bark, acorns covered in a furry cap, and large glossy green lobed leaves. This cold-hardy tree thrives in USDA zones 3 to 8 and is found in Florida’s panhandle. Bur oaks grow 70 to 90 ft. (21 – 27 m) tall and up to 80 ft. (25 m) wide. WebAlgae, lichens and moss often form green or grey, powdery or mossy, crusty growths on the stems, branches and trunks of trees and shrubs. While this can worry gardeners, these growths are harmless, although may occasionally indicate a lack of vigour in the affected plant. WebApr 26, 2024 · Ball moss is found in the United States in Georgia, Florida, Louisiana, Texas, Arizona, and coastal South Carolina. Tillandsia Recurvata also grows in Argentina, Chile the West Indies, and Mexico. most of Central and South America, and many of the islands in the West Indies.

Reindeer Moss, Cladonia spp., includes several species of lichen that can be found growing on the ground throughout Florida in undisturbed, dry upland habitats. It is typically abundant in areas that have not been exposed to fire for many years.
